The Thames by Moonlight with Southwark Bridge, 1884
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a mesmerizing oil painting that captures the enchanting beauty of London's iconic river under the soft glow of moonlight. Created by renowned artist John Atkinson Grimshaw, this masterpiece from the 19th century seamlessly blends art and astronomy to create a scene that transports viewers to another time. In this artwork, Grimshaw skillfully depicts Southwark Bridge standing proudly over the tranquil waters of the River Thames. The bridge acts as a gateway into an ethereal world illuminated by the gentle radiance of the moon above. As night falls, boats and barges gracefully navigate through these mystical waters, their reflections shimmering on its surface. The painting not only showcases Grimshaw's exceptional talent for capturing light and shadow but also highlights his attention to detail in portraying architectural marvels like St Paul's Cathedral in all its grandeur. This religious symbol stands tall amidst London's cityscape, reminding viewers of Britain's rich Christian heritage. Grimshaw masterfully combines elements of geography and transportation within this nocturnal landscape. The composition invites us to contemplate both natural wonders such as rivers and celestial bodies like the moon while showcasing man-made structures that define urban life.
